Okra & Turmeric Flowers at Kevin Cruz’s Food Forest in Naples, Florida

Kevin Cruz’s agroecological food forest is in its second year of growth after he started farming his family’s land in southwest Florida. Lots in the swamps are quite large and Kevin’s been expanding his operation bit by bit, chopping and dropping, building soil, and growing food. On my last visit in January of 2022, he experienced an uncommon cold streak where it dropped below freezing three nights in a row. The food forrest was set back a bit, but already by August there’s nothing but abundance!

Kevin manages his family’s land as an agroecological farm in the states as well as in their hometown in Las Guacamayas, Honduras.
